Description
Tetrapropylammonium is a quaternary ammonium cation with four propyl substituents around the central nitrogen. It is an organic compound known for its unique structure and properties, which make it suitable for various applications across different industries.

Check Digit Verification of cas no
The CAS Registry Mumber 13010-31-6 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 1,3,0,1 and 0 respectively; the second part has 2 digits, 3 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 13010-31:
(7*1)+(6*3)+(5*0)+(4*1)+(3*0)+(2*3)+(1*1)=36
36 % 10 = 6
So 13010-31-6 is a valid CAS Registry Number.
